Clifton Town Meeting holding special meeting to cancel bike infrastructure.

267 Upvotes

Extending the bike lanes on Clifton Ave to cross Ludlow and continue down to Bryant have been approved and funded by DOTE.

Some boomers on the CTM board are trying to get the new bike lane cancelled in favor of more parking spots.

If you care about bike infrastructure and walkable communities this would be a good meeting to show up to as President Ben Pantoja is trying to sneak this by.

Meeting is at Clifton Rec Center at 7:00.

You better reconsider visiting this place. I had an appt for a toothache and was left in the lobby 2 hours after my appt. until I was seen. They started calling other people back who showed up after me, but wait it gets even better. After x-rays an alleged doctor came in and said ok it’s infected. I said I’ve had two root canals done on this tooth within 4 years. He said yeah that happens. So you have two options one is to pull it for 490 or do another root canal for 5400. They really pushed care credit hard. He said keep in mind it could fail again. I said I want the pain to stop before any treatment and he said prescribing you something is a liability. Dental assistant told me to go to urgent care for antibiotics. I think he felt bad the dentist treated me the way he did. They got me for 165 dollars. I went to an urgent care, another 100 dollars and they prescribed me antibiotics. Is there a proper way I can report this quack?

GCWW shutting water off with 30 min notice?

7 Upvotes

Hey everyone,

GCWW is working on lead pipe replacement on my street for the past month. Today, my apartment gave us 30 minutes notice that the water would be shut off at 9:30am for the next 8-10 hours. Is GCWW allowed to shut our water off with no notice? Or is our apartment group more likely at fault for not providing timely updates? Just seems absurd that water could be shut off with little to no notice. Today has been the least amount of notice given - over the previous weeks I have received anywhere from 4 hour to 3 days of notice prior to shut off.

UPDATE : Property management provided me with the notice - GCWW left a written notice at like 830am on the office door only. So property management not at fault, just shitty timing from GCWW.
